As an expert in industrial automation, I can tell you that the FOXBORO FPS400-24 P0922YU is a fundamental and highly reliable component within the Foxboro I/A Series and EcoStruxure Foxboro DCS. It is a DIN-Rail Mounted Power Supply Unit, specifically designed to provide stable 24 VDC power to the system’s critical DIN rail-mounted baseplates and the Fieldbus Modules (FBMs), Field Control Processors (FCPs), and Fieldbus Communication Modules (FCMs) they house.

The “FPS” in its name stands for “Foxboro Power Supply,” and “400-24” indicates it’s a 400 Watt power supply providing 24 VDC output. The “P0922YU” is the specific Foxboro part number for this particular model.

Detailed Product Description:

In any modern industrial control system, the power supply is not just an accessory; it’s the lifeblood. A stable, clean, and reliable power source is paramount to the proper functioning of sensitive electronics, especially in a distributed control environment. The FOXBORO FPS400-24 P0922YU is precisely engineered to meet these rigorous demands for the Foxboro I/A Series and its successor, EcoStruxure Foxboro DCS. This is a robust, high-performance power supply that ensures the continuous and accurate operation of your Fieldbus Modules (FBMs), Field Control Processors (FCPs), and Fieldbus Communication Modules (FCMs) by providing them with conditioned 24 VDC power.

Core Features and Reliability: Powering the Heart of Your DCS

What distinguishes the FOXBORO FPS400-24 P0922YU as a top-tier industrial power supply?

  1. High Power Output (400W @ 24VDC): With a 400 Watt output capability, this power supply can support a significant load of FBMs, FCPs, and FCMs on multiple baseplates within a subsystem. This allows for flexible system sizing and future expansion.

  2. Wide-Range AC/DC Input (P0922YU specific): The P0922YU model is highly versatile, accepting a wide range of input voltages from 85 to 265 VAC (47-63 Hz) or 108 to 145 VDC (nominal 125 VDC). This “universal” input capability makes it suitable for deployment in facilities worldwide, accommodating different regional power standards without requiring specific ordering. (Note: There is also a P0922YC variant that takes a 24 VDC input).

  3. Exceptional Efficiency: These power supplies boast very high efficiency, with the P0922YU achieving up to 95% efficiency. High efficiency translates directly into less wasted energy (less heat generated), which improves reliability, extends the lifespan of the unit, and contributes to lower operating costs due to reduced power consumption and less demand on cooling systems.

  4. Power Factor Correction (PFC): For AC input models like the P0922YU, advanced circuitry provides active sinusoidal current profile for near-unity controlled power factor. This means the power supply draws current more efficiently from the AC line, reducing harmonic distortion and improving overall power quality for the plant’s electrical system.

  5. Robust Protection Features:

    • Current Limiting: The power supply operates as a constant voltage source. If the load current attempts to exceed approximately 110% of its maximum rating, the output voltage will decrease to limit the current, protecting both the power supply and the connected devices from overcurrent conditions.
    • Overvoltage Protection: It has factory-set overvoltage shutdown circuitry (typically at 28.0 VDC for FBM/FCM/FCP applications). If the output voltage exceeds this limit, the power supply automatically shuts down to protect sensitive control system components.
    • Transformer Isolated Output: The 24 VDC output is transformer isolated, providing a critical layer of electrical isolation between the input power and the control system, enhancing safety and noise immunity.
  6. Sealed and Gasketed Design (Convection Cooling): The robust construction features a sealed and gasketed housing. This design is highly beneficial for industrial environments because it eliminates the need for cooling fans, which are common failure points in traditional power supplies. The sealed nature also protects internal components from airborne contaminants, dust, moisture, and corrosive atmospheres (such as those containing hydrogen sulfides or chlorine), significantly reducing maintenance requirements and extending operational life. This design contributes to its G3 rating for harsh environments (per ISA Standard S71.04).

  7. Hazardous Location Certifications: The FPS400-24 is agency certified for use in Class I, Division 2, and Zone 2 hazardous locations (e.g., UL and UL-C listed, CENELEC certified). This makes it suitable for deployment in areas where flammable gases or vapors may occasionally be present, a common requirement in industries like oil & gas and chemical processing.

  8. Status Alarm Output: It includes a Form C relay output that activates to indicate the absence of the 24 VDC output (e.g., in case of a fault or shutdown). This allows operators or higher-level control systems to be immediately alerted to a power supply issue, enabling prompt troubleshooting and recovery. Visual LED indicators also provide local status.

  9. DIN-Rail Mounting: Designed for easy and secure mounting on standard DIN rails, simplifying installation and enabling a clean, organized layout within control cabinets. The mounting bracket can be rotated for horizontal or vertical DIN rail mounting, or even removed for direct wall mounting.

While the FPS400-24 provides power to the 200 Series baseplates, it’s generally recommended that the same power supply not be used to power both the baseplates and external field devices to maintain system integrity.

Technical Specifications:

Parameter Typical Value
Product Type DIN-Rail Mounted Power Supply
Model/Part Number FPS400-24 (P0922YU)
Output Voltage 24 VDC
Output Power 400 Watts
Output Current 16.7 A (at 24 VDC)
Input Voltage (P0922YU) 85 to 265 VAC (47 to 63 Hz) or 108 to 145 VDC (125 VDC nominal)
Efficiency (at max output) Up to 95% (for P0922YU)
Power Factor Near unity (for AC inputs, P0922YU)
Inrush Current 20 A at 110 VAC, 40 A at 220 VAC (peak, cold start)
Current Limiting Active, to ~110% of max current
Overvoltage Protection Factory set at 28.0 VDC (auto shutdown)
Isolation Voltages 3000 VAC input to output, 500 VAC output to chassis ground, 1500 VAC input to chassis ground
Startup Time (Soft-Start) 3 s typical (5 s max)
Load Transient Response Recovers within 50 ms to within regulation limits
Operating Temperature 40°C to +70°C (-40°F to +158°F)
Storage Temperature -40°C to +85°C (-40°F to +185°F)
Relative Humidity 5% to 95% (non-condensing)
Altitude -300 to +3,000 m operating
Environmental Rating Class G3 (Harsh Environments) per ISA Standard S71.04
Cooling Convection (no fans)
Certifications UL®, UL-C (UL 1950), CENELEC Ex nA IIC T3 (for Zone 2), ABS/BV Marine
Mounting DIN Rail (horizontal or vertical), Wall Mount
Status Indicators Visual LEDs (undervoltage, normal operation), Form C relay alarm output
Weight ~2.0 kg (4.4 lbs)
Dimensions (HxWxD) ~230 x 112 x 65 mm (9.06 x 4.41 x 2.56 in)

Related Products:

The FOXBORO FPS400-24 P0922YU works in close conjunction with:

  • Foxboro DIN Rail Mounted Baseplates: These are the physical carriers (e.g., P0922RC, RH924YF) that the FBMs, FCPs, and FCMs plug into. The FPS400-24 supplies power directly to these baseplates.
  • Foxboro Fieldbus Modules (FBMs): All 200 Series FBMs (e.g., FBM201, FBM202, FBM205, FBM211, FBM242) rely on the 24 VDC power supplied by the FPS400-24.
  • Foxboro Field Control Processors (FCPs): Controllers like FCP270 and FCP280, which are typically mounted on dedicated baseplates, receive their operating power from the FPS400-24.
  • Foxboro Fieldbus Communication Modules (FCMs): Modules like FCM10E or FCM10EF, also mounted on baseplates, are powered by the FPS400-24 to facilitate communication across the Fieldbus.
  • Redundant Power Supply Configurations: Often, two FPS400-24 units (or a combination of P0922YU and P0922YC if DC input is also used) are used in a redundant setup, with their outputs connected to redundant power input terminals on the baseplates to provide fault tolerance.
  • Power Distribution Cables and Terminal Blocks: Specific cables are typically used to connect the FPS400-24 to the baseplates, ensuring proper power distribution.
